        public void Test_Elements_Displacement()
        {
            // Initialisation
            IUnivers u = new Univers2D(50, 50);
            IElement e = ChemicalElementFactory.GetInstance().Create("Carbone");
            Assert.AreEqual(e.Location.X, 0);
            Assert.AreEqual(e.Location.Y, 0);
            Assert.AreEqual(e.Displacement.X, 0);
            Assert.AreEqual(e.Displacement.Y, 0);

            // On déplace l'élément en passant par sa méthode
            e.MoveStrategy = new BoundedMovesStrategy(u);
            e.Displacement = new Vector(2, 5);
            e.UpdateLocation();
            Assert.AreEqual(e.Location.X, 2);
            Assert.AreEqual(e.Location.Y, 5);
            Assert.AreEqual(e.Displacement.X, 2);
            Assert.AreEqual(e.Displacement.Y, 5);

            // On déplace l'élément en passant par sa stratégie
            e.MoveStrategy.ExecuteMove(e);
            Assert.AreEqual(e.Location.X, 4);
            Assert.AreEqual(e.Location.Y, 10);
            Assert.AreEqual(e.Displacement.X, 2);
            Assert.AreEqual(e.Displacement.Y, 5);

        }
